COVID-19 vaccines offer strong protection against Delta variant; protection may wane in older adults

  672 Views

eMediNexus    12 September 2021

Three studies in the United States have suggested that COVID-19 vaccines offer strong protection against hospitalization and death, even amid the spread of the highly transmissible Delta variant. However, the protection extended by the vaccines seems to be waning among older individuals, particularly among those aged 75 years and older.

Data on hospital admissions from nine states during the period when the Delta variant was dominating also indicated that the Moderna vaccine was comparatively more effective at preventing hospitalizations among individuals of all ages compared to the Pfizer/BioNTech or Johnson & Johnson COVID-19 vaccines. In that study involving over 32,000 visits to urgent care centers, emergency rooms and hospitals, the Moderna vaccine was found to be 95% effective at preventing hospitalization, while the Pfizer vaccine was 80% effective and the J&J vaccine was 60% effective… (Reuters, September 10, 2021)
